Oh and one more thing, i had to manually add geos and geos_c.dll someplace 
thats also in the system path of course, i just put them to c:\python33\dlls. 
Since they are not included in the git repo, i downloaded the appropriate egg 
file for shapely 1.2.18 for py 2.7 for windows 64bit and got them from there. 
Otherwise shapely would complain about not being able to load these dlls.

I have two branches on the go, so let me describe them.

py3: https://github.com/mwtoews/shapely/commits/py3

I initially had a `py3` branch, which had the minimal changes to
support both Python 2 and 3 from a single code base. The biggest
change here, besides the obvious, is the switch in setup.py from
setuptools to distutils. (Somehow, another branch of mine, `v13`,
slipped into this branch for a few weeks up until now.. sorry if you
pulled this and it is different. Admittedly, I'm still learning the
dark art of git, which I also used to restore the branch to an
intended previous state, plus merging the latest commits from upstream
master.) This branch should be the prime place for testing to make
sure most of the Python 2/3 features work. For instance, do speedups
work for everyone?

v13: https://github.com/mwtoews/shapely/commits/v13

The `v13` branch is a somewhat parallel branch to implement some more
aggressive changes for version 1.3, including reader/writer classes
for WKT/WKB formats, use of GEOS version numbers (rather than C API
version numbers) to determine capabilities, and a few other things.
(At present, it is a few commits behind upstream master, but I can
merge this). The wkt output is different from this branch, and I'd
like to do some more testing to see if the performance is
good/reliable.

Furthermore, with both branches I'm using Travis CI to do an automated
QA/QC, which are mostly looking good. Except for some GEOS
functionality mismatches, which can be skipped with some features from
a newer unittest package
(https://github.com/Toblerity/Shapely/issues/70), which are yet to be
committed pending on any comments on the direction of unit tests.
